Step-by-Step Guide to Taking a Screenshot on Dell Laptop Windows 10

Capturing your screen on a Dell laptop can be incredibly useful, whether you’re saving an important document or sharing a funny moment. Let’s walk through the steps to take that perfect screenshot.

Step 1: Press the "PrtScn" Button

Locate and press the "PrtScn" (Print Screen) button on your keyboard.

This button, usually found at the top of your keyboard, captures everything visible on your screen. There’s no immediate visual indication, but trust that it worked!

Step 2: Use "Windows + Shift + S" for a Selection

Press "Windows + Shift + S" to open the snipping tool.

This shortcut lets you choose a specific part of your screen to capture. Your screen will dim, and you can drag to select the area you want to capture.

Step 3: Open an Editing Program

Open a program like Paint or Word.

Once you’ve captured the screenshot, open a program where you can paste and save it. These programs allow you to edit and format your image.

Step 4: Paste the Screenshot

Press "Ctrl + V" to paste your screenshot into the program.

This action drops your captured image wherever your cursor is, making it easy to edit or move.

Step 5: Save the Screenshot

Save your image by clicking "File" and then "Save As."

Choose your desired format (like JPEG or PNG), name your file, and pick a location to save it on your computer.

After following these steps, you’ll have your screenshot saved and ready to use however you need!

Tips for Taking Screenshot on Dell Laptop Windows 10

  • Use the Snipping Tool for more options, like free-form or window snips.
  • Save screenshots directly by pressing "Windows + PrtScn."
  • Organize your screenshots by naming them clearly and storing them in dedicated folders.
  • For quick editing, consider using built-in tools like Paint 3D.
  • Add annotations or highlights using tools available in photo editing programs.

Frequently Asked Questions

What if my "PrtScn" key isn’t working?

Make sure F-Lock or Function Lock is not enabled, as it might disable the key.

Where do screenshots go after I press "PrtScn"?

Screenshots go to your clipboard. You need to paste them into a program to view or save.

Can I take a screenshot of just one window?

Yes, press "Alt + PrtScn" to capture only the active window.

How do I take a scrolling screenshot?

You’ll need third-party software like Snagit for scrolling screenshots.

Is there any built-in software for screenshots?

Yes, the Snipping Tool and Snip & Sketch are built into Windows 10 for more advanced options.
